Jurgen Klopp has insisted that “revenge” is not a motivator for Liverpool against Real Madrid in the Champions League. The LaLiga giants claimed a third successive crown in Europe’s elite club competition in May 2018 by beating the Reds 3-1 in the Kyiv showpiece, where Mohamed Salah suffered a shoulder injury following Sergio Ramos’ challenge.
